May 23 proclaimed ‘Maddie’s Promise Day’; annual gala planned for the fall

May 22, 2024 By Carol Britton Meyer

The Select Board this week proclaimed Thursday, May 23, “Maddie’s Promise Day” in recognition of  Maddie’s Promise, a non-profit organization started in memory of Hingham resident Maddie McCoy, who passed on in May 2019 from a rare pediatric cancer.

Ann McCoy, Maddie’s mother, was present to hear the proclamation read and thanked the Hingham community for its support of Maddie’s Promise. “It means a lot to us,” she said. “We live in the best community in the world.”

The proclamation honors Maddie for her “courage, gentle spirit, and generosity in bringing a smile to everyone she met. . . . Maddie has been an inspiration to all who met her and hear about her courageous battle . . .”

As an example, Maddie created art to sell to raise money for pediatric cancer research while receiving treatment at Boston Children’s Hospital.

The proclamation urges all Hingham citizens to observe “Maddie’s Promise Day” by emulating “the spirit and attitude of Maddie McCoy and being the change the world needs.”

The fourth annual “Evening of Promise” will be held on Oct. 18. All funds raised go to Maddie’s Promise to promote pediatric cancer research and life-saving treatment for children.
